#f33043 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f33043 is composed of 95.3% red, 18.8%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80.2% magenta, 72.4%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 354.2 degrees, a saturation of 89% and a lightness of 57.1%. #f33043 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6086 with #e70000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

Shades and Tints of #f33043
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0102 is the darkest color, while #fffc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#f33043
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#968d8e is the less saturated color, while #fb283c is the most saturated one.
